VFD顯示驅(qū)動和控制芯片TP6312F在電磁爐顯示電路中的應(yīng)用
發(fā)布時間:2007/8/28 0:00:00 訪問次數(shù):502
摘要:介紹了VFD顯示驅(qū)動和控制芯片TP6312F的組成結(jié)構(gòu)、性能特點和編程指令,對TP6312F驅(qū)動的VFD在電磁爐顯示電路中的應(yīng)用做了詳細(xì)論述,給出了該應(yīng)用系統(tǒng)的硬件電路和軟件流程。
關(guān)鍵詞:家用電器;VFD;TP6312F
真空熒光顯示屏VFD(Vacuum Fluorescent Display)是1966年日本發(fā)明的一種自發(fā)光平板顯示器件,現(xiàn)已在工業(yè)、商業(yè)特別是家用電器數(shù)字化產(chǎn)品領(lǐng)域得到了廣泛應(yīng)用。VFD是一種特殊變體的三級真空管,其電子從負(fù)極(燈絲)發(fā)射出來,通過柵網(wǎng)加速后撞擊正極表面附著的磷光體從而發(fā)光。VFD的主要性能是:自動發(fā)光、高清晰度和高亮度顯示、低壓操作、低功耗、可靠且使用壽命長、有從紅色到藍(lán)色多種色彩(使用濾色器可獲得更多色彩)、寬視角、反應(yīng)速度快等,F(xiàn)在市面上的電磁爐大多采用數(shù)字LED顯示,也有的采用字段LCD顯示屏,筆者開發(fā)的首款電磁爐采用的就是圖形點陣LCD顯示屏,但考慮到成本、顯示亮度及電磁爐本身的強(qiáng)電流、強(qiáng)磁場等因素和VFD的諸多特點,最終選擇VFD作為電磁爐顯示屏。
圖1
1 TP6312F控制/驅(qū)動芯片
1.1 TP6312F的組成及功能
TP6312F是TOPRO(臺灣凌越科技)公司生產(chǎn)的VFD專用控制/驅(qū)動器,可完成段節(jié)式VFD器件的控制與驅(qū)動。該器件為44腳LQFP封裝,有11個段(陽極)輸出腳、6個位(柵極)輸出腳、5個段/位(陽極/柵極)兩用輸出腳、4位開關(guān)量輸入腳、4位LED驅(qū)動腳以及4×6鍵盤輸入腳。TP6312F內(nèi)含1個顯示RAM、2個4位鎖存器、1個亮度控制電路、鍵值數(shù)據(jù)RAM及鍵盤掃描電路,可通過3線或4線串口與MCU進(jìn)行連接。MCU可以通過串行接口將數(shù)據(jù)寫入顯示RAM和LED驅(qū)動鎖存器,也可以從鍵值數(shù)據(jù)RAM和開關(guān)量輸入鎖存器中讀出內(nèi)容。
1.2 TP6312F的控制命令
TP6312F具有顯示模式設(shè)置、數(shù)據(jù)設(shè)置、顯示存儲器地址設(shè)置和顯示控制設(shè)置命令等4條命令,其具體格式如圖1所示。由圖1可見,通過顯示模式設(shè)置命令可使TP6312F匹配不同結(jié)構(gòu)的VFD顯示屏。在顯示存儲地址設(shè)置命令中,地址的取值范圍為00H~15H,大于15H的取值被視為無效;通過執(zhí)行顯示模式設(shè)置命令,系統(tǒng)顯示會被強(qiáng)行關(guān)閉,此時要恢復(fù)顯示,必須執(zhí)行一次顯示控制設(shè)置命令。在向LED端口寫數(shù)據(jù)、讀鍵值數(shù)據(jù)、讀SW數(shù)據(jù)時,系統(tǒng)并未涉及特定存儲單元的地址,而是通過數(shù)據(jù)設(shè)置命令來獲得其結(jié)果,執(zhí)行完數(shù)據(jù)設(shè)置命令后,即可將其存儲到指定的存儲單元或?qū)⒅付ù鎯卧膬?nèi)容寫到TP6312F中。
圖2
2 電磁爐顯示系統(tǒng)設(shè)計
2.1 系統(tǒng)的硬件組成
電磁爐的前面板電路由微控制器W78E58B、VFD驅(qū)動電路TP6312F、電磁爐VFD顯示器件及一些分立器件組成。該系統(tǒng)電路如圖2所示。其中W78E58B是Winbond公司的微處理器,電磁爐VFD具有4個柵極Pin4~Pin7和16Pin9~Pin24個陽極。W78E58B和TP6312F采用三線制接法,W78E58B的P1.0和CS相連,P1.1和CLK相連,P1.2則和DI、DO相連。因DO口為N溝道開漏輸出,故需接上拉電阻R7以形成數(shù)字電平信號。TP6312F內(nèi)置OSC,其振蕩頻率由R1決定,R1的典型值為56kΩ。
2.2 鍵盤電路
鍵盤電路共有11個鍵。圖中鍵盤電路的D2、D4采用的是1N4148, 可用于隔離陽極驅(qū)動電壓。TP6312F內(nèi)嵌硬件鍵掃描電路,并在Sj/Kj(j=0~5)線輸出鍵掃描信號,Ki(i=0~3) 線接收鍵值(在顯示周期的末端鎖存至內(nèi)部RAM),因此,由Ki(i=0~3)和Sj/Kj(j=0~5)可以構(gòu)成4×6鍵盤矩陣。該系統(tǒng)中,矩陣鍵盤用2×4鍵組成時,S0/K0、S1/K1線作為輸出鍵掃描信號,Ki(i=0~3)線用于接收鍵值。根據(jù)電路圖的接法,若有鍵按下,鍵碼內(nèi)部RAM的相應(yīng)位置1。其余3個鍵由SWn(n=0~3)線組成。SWn(n=0~3)為4位開關(guān)輸入端,設(shè)計者可根據(jù)需要自行定義。這里用其中的三位(SW0,SW1,SW3)來作為按鍵輸入,根據(jù)電路圖中的接法,開關(guān)量輸入內(nèi)部 RAM的相應(yīng)位應(yīng)置0。
2.3 顯示電路
TP6312F采用負(fù)壓輸出,陽極(Anode pin)在邏輯0時輸出負(fù)壓,在邏輯1時輸出電平為0伏。為驅(qū)動VFD,需下拉燈絲繞組中心抽頭的電位。圖2中穩(wěn)壓管WD1的穩(wěn)壓值由VFD的截止電壓來決定。動態(tài)掃描顯示由TP6312F內(nèi)部電路自
摘要:介紹了VFD顯示驅(qū)動和控制芯片TP6312F的組成結(jié)構(gòu)、性能特點和編程指令,對TP6312F驅(qū)動的VFD在電磁爐顯示電路中的應(yīng)用做了詳細(xì)論述,給出了該應(yīng)用系統(tǒng)的硬件電路和軟件流程。
關(guān)鍵詞:家用電器;VFD;TP6312F
真空熒光顯示屏VFD(Vacuum Fluorescent Display)是1966年日本發(fā)明的一種自發(fā)光平板顯示器件,現(xiàn)已在工業(yè)、商業(yè)特別是家用電器數(shù)字化產(chǎn)品領(lǐng)域得到了廣泛應(yīng)用。VFD是一種特殊變體的三級真空管,其電子從負(fù)極(燈絲)發(fā)射出來,通過柵網(wǎng)加速后撞擊正極表面附著的磷光體從而發(fā)光。VFD的主要性能是:自動發(fā)光、高清晰度和高亮度顯示、低壓操作、低功耗、可靠且使用壽命長、有從紅色到藍(lán)色多種色彩(使用濾色器可獲得更多色彩)、寬視角、反應(yīng)速度快等,F(xiàn)在市面上的電磁爐大多采用數(shù)字LED顯示,也有的采用字段LCD顯示屏,筆者開發(fā)的首款電磁爐采用的就是圖形點陣LCD顯示屏,但考慮到成本、顯示亮度及電磁爐本身的強(qiáng)電流、強(qiáng)磁場等因素和VFD的諸多特點,最終選擇VFD作為電磁爐顯示屏。
圖1
1 TP6312F控制/驅(qū)動芯片
1.1 TP6312F的組成及功能
TP6312F是TOPRO(臺灣凌越科技)公司生產(chǎn)的VFD專用控制/驅(qū)動器,可完成段節(jié)式VFD器件的控制與驅(qū)動。該器件為44腳LQFP封裝,有11個段(陽極)輸出腳、6個位(柵極)輸出腳、5個段/位(陽極/柵極)兩用輸出腳、4位開關(guān)量輸入腳、4位LED驅(qū)動腳以及4×6鍵盤輸入腳。TP6312F內(nèi)含1個顯示RAM、2個4位鎖存器、1個亮度控制電路、鍵值數(shù)據(jù)RAM及鍵盤掃描電路,可通過3線或4線串口與MCU進(jìn)行連接。MCU可以通過串行接口將數(shù)據(jù)寫入顯示RAM和LED驅(qū)動鎖存器,也可以從鍵值數(shù)據(jù)RAM和開關(guān)量輸入鎖存器中讀出內(nèi)容。
1.2 TP6312F的控制命令
TP6312F具有顯示模式設(shè)置、數(shù)據(jù)設(shè)置、顯示存儲器地址設(shè)置和顯示控制設(shè)置命令等4條命令,其具體格式如圖1所示。由圖1可見,通過顯示模式設(shè)置命令可使TP6312F匹配不同結(jié)構(gòu)的VFD顯示屏。在顯示存儲地址設(shè)置命令中,地址的取值范圍為00H~15H,大于15H的取值被視為無效;通過執(zhí)行顯示模式設(shè)置命令,系統(tǒng)顯示會被強(qiáng)行關(guān)閉,此時要恢復(fù)顯示,必須執(zhí)行一次顯示控制設(shè)置命令。在向LED端口寫數(shù)據(jù)、讀鍵值數(shù)據(jù)、讀SW數(shù)據(jù)時,系統(tǒng)并未涉及特定存儲單元的地址,而是通過數(shù)據(jù)設(shè)置命令來獲得其結(jié)果,執(zhí)行完數(shù)據(jù)設(shè)置命令后,即可將其存儲到指定的存儲單元或?qū)⒅付ù鎯卧膬?nèi)容寫到TP6312F中。
圖2
2 電磁爐顯示系統(tǒng)設(shè)計
2.1 系統(tǒng)的硬件組成
電磁爐的前面板電路由微控制器W78E58B、VFD驅(qū)動電路TP6312F、電磁爐VFD顯示器件及一些分立器件組成。該系統(tǒng)電路如圖2所示。其中W78E58B是Winbond公司的微處理器,電磁爐VFD具有4個柵極Pin4~Pin7和16Pin9~Pin24個陽極。W78E58B和TP6312F采用三線制接法,W78E58B的P1.0和CS相連,P1.1和CLK相連,P1.2則和DI、DO相連。因DO口為N溝道開漏輸出,故需接上拉電阻R7以形成數(shù)字電平信號。TP6312F內(nèi)置OSC,其振蕩頻率由R1決定,R1的典型值為56kΩ。
2.2 鍵盤電路
鍵盤電路共有11個鍵。圖中鍵盤電路的D2、D4采用的是1N4148, 可用于隔離陽極驅(qū)動電壓。TP6312F內(nèi)嵌硬件鍵掃描電路,并在Sj/Kj(j=0~5)線輸出鍵掃描信號,Ki(i=0~3) 線接收鍵值(在顯示周期的末端鎖存至內(nèi)部RAM),因此,由Ki(i=0~3)和Sj/Kj(j=0~5)可以構(gòu)成4×6鍵盤矩陣。該系統(tǒng)中,矩陣鍵盤用2×4鍵組成時,S0/K0、S1/K1線作為輸出鍵掃描信號,Ki(i=0~3)線用于接收鍵值。根據(jù)電路圖的接法,若有鍵按下,鍵碼內(nèi)部RAM的相應(yīng)位置1。其余3個鍵由SWn(n=0~3)線組成。SWn(n=0~3)為4位開關(guān)輸入端,設(shè)計者可根據(jù)需要自行定義。這里用其中的三位(SW0,SW1,SW3)來作為按鍵輸入,根據(jù)電路圖中的接法,開關(guān)量輸入內(nèi)部 RAM的相應(yīng)位應(yīng)置0。
2.3 顯示電路
TP6312F采用負(fù)壓輸出,陽極(Anode pin)在邏輯0時輸出負(fù)壓,在邏輯1時輸出電平為0伏。為驅(qū)動VFD,需下拉燈絲繞組中心抽頭的電位。圖2中穩(wěn)壓管WD1的穩(wěn)壓值由VFD的截止電壓來決定。動態(tài)掃描顯示由TP6312F內(nèi)部電路自
熱門點擊
- 單片機(jī)系統(tǒng)中的多任務(wù)多線程機(jī)制的實現(xiàn)
- 基于UC3846的新型開關(guān)電源的設(shè)計
- ISD4004語音芯片在語音報站器中的應(yīng)用
- PT2262/PT2272編解碼IC在視頻切
- 基于AD8108的寬頻帶低串?dāng)_視頻切換矩陣的
- 嵌入式微處理器MCF5249及其應(yīng)用
- μPD3575DCCD圖像傳感器的原理及應(yīng)用
- 語音處理芯片AC48105在低速語音編碼設(shè)備
- 基于FM1715的TypeB卡閱讀器設(shè)計
- 簡化電動機(jī)運動的光電定位控制電路
推薦技術(shù)資料
- 分立器件&無源元件選型及工作原
- 新一代“超越EUV”光刻系統(tǒng)參
- 最新品BAT激光器制造工藝設(shè)計
- 新款汽車SoC產(chǎn)品Malibo
- 新芯片品類FPCU(現(xiàn)場可編程
- 電動汽車動力總成系統(tǒng)̴
- 多媒體協(xié)處理器SM501在嵌入式系統(tǒng)中的應(yīng)用
- 基于IEEE802.11b的EPA溫度變送器
- QUICCEngine新引擎推動IP網(wǎng)絡(luò)革新
- SoC面世八年后的產(chǎn)業(yè)機(jī)遇
- MPC8xx系列處理器的嵌入式系統(tǒng)電源設(shè)計
- dsPIC及其在交流變頻調(diào)速中的應(yīng)用研究